The 17HM2 is my favorite cartridge for shooting fox squirrels and might well be the best cartridge ever designed for shooting tree squirrels.

I have several rifles chambered for it, both factory and parts guns. Even the least expensive Marlin and Savage is close enough to the Anschutz 1502 accuracy wise, with the right ammo, that the average shooter probably wouldn't notice the difference.

From my POV, The 17HM2's biggest weakness is that the long discontinued Eley ammo was match grade accurate and none of the CCI and Hornady ammo seems to be quite as accurate in any rifle that I shoot it in. That isn't to say that CCI and Hornady ammo isn't accurate, just that in most cases it isn't quite as accurate as the Eley. The most recent 17HM2 ammo that I've purchased, CCI with a yellow tipped bullet, is the most accurate ammo from CCI or Hornady that I've seen. Close to the Eley, but still not Eley accurate.

The 17HM2 is a niche cartridge that shines within its performance window, but it will never be as fast as the 17HMR and many people judge these two cartridges by their velocity numbers alone.

The only semi-auto 17HM2 that I've shot have been Ruger 10/22 conversions that balanced on the knife edge of safety. If you want to do more research, there is lots of 17HM2 information, both real and imaginary, on RFC.

Elkivory: I currently own and shoot 4 (four) heavy barrel Rifles in caliber 17 Mach2 - and it IS nearly a "religious" experience enjoying the fun and accuracy and lethality this tiny little imp of a cartridge provides me.
My group of heavy barrel 17 Mach2's consists of an amazingly accurate Anschutz 1502, and an amazingly accurate Kimber SVT (Silhouette/Varmint/Target with Leupold 6.5x20 EFR scope), a Marlin 917 M2S and a humble but still very accurate N.E.F Handi-Rifle Sportster.
I have also shot, to a great extent, my friends Ruger MK-II pistol that was converted to 17 Mach2 - a more fun pistol would be hard to come by!
All the above are just great fun to shoot and again are amazingly lethal on small game and Varmints (both feathered and furred). To date I have killed one Badger (large boar) with the 17 Mach2 and it was dispatched with one shot to the Adams Apple area at 80 yards.
I have several "spots" to Hunt Ground Squirrels near ranch houses and the 17 Mach2 is used here exclusively as it is rather quiet and the 17 Hornady projectiles I use do NOT ricochet!
The only drawback to the 17 Mach2 is the current PRICE of 17 Mach2 ammo - my local gunshops have it on the shelves at $10.99 per box of 50.
I am so thankful I put in a lifetime supply of Hornady 17 Mach2 ammo back when it was MUCH cheaper than it is now.

I had a couple of the 452s in 17HM2 and 22LR. While they were accurate rifles, I never warmed up to the stock geometry and the backward safeties, so although it is unusual for me to sell guns, rather than having them gather dust on a shelf, they went away. The Anschutz 1502 and Marlin 917M2S get most of my 17HM2 work, with the Anschutz being a little more accurate and the Marlin is stainless so it gets the call when the weather is anything less than perfect.

I will say for the record that the only 17HM2 that I've owned that wasn't a particularly good shooter was one of the non-cataloged run of Ruger Americans that SAS had made up for Whittaker Guns in Owensboro, KY, back in 2019. It certainly wasn't Darrick's fault, but since I wasn't the only person who had a problem with a rifle from that run, it appears as though Ruger just didn't get those rifles right.
